Whether you're a high school student or an adult, working toward a degree or just taking a few classes, the Office of Admissions can show you how easy it is to enroll and get started. You can pursue all your educational goals at IU Northwest because we offer:

  • Nationally recognized academic programs
  • Outstanding faculty dedicated to teaching
  • Personal attention and small class size
  • Flexible course schedules with day, evening, and weekend classes
  • Academic and career support services
  • Affordable costs, financial aid, and payment plans
  • A student body of over 5,000 - half recent high school graduates and half nontraditional students

Application Deadlines

Applications should be received by the following dates, depending on the semester you intend to enroll:

  • Fall Semester - August 1
    • Applications are still being accepted. Applicants should bring all official transcripts, a completed application and the $25 application fee into the Office of Admissions as soon as possible.
  • Spring Semester - December 1
  • Summer Session I - May 1
  • Summer Session II - June 1

Apply Online

Perhaps the easiest way to apply is to complete an online application. If you have applied to IU Northwest campus within the past 24 months, DO NOT APPLY ON-LINE. It is not necessary and your fee will not be refunded. Instead, update your previous application by calling 219-980-6991 or 1-888-968-7486.
